What To Look For In A Plumber
- A licensed plumber with experience in your area is essential.
- Check their reviews and ratings on websites like Yelp or Google.
- Ask for references from friends, family, or neighbors who have had similar plumbing issues.
- Make sure they provide clear quotes and estimates before starting the job.
If you're planning to hire a plumber for a major renovation or repair, research their company history and check if they are insured and bonded.
Red Flags To Watch Out For
- A plumber who is new to your area may not have experience with local regulations or plumbing codes.
- If you're on a tight budget, consider hiring a contractor who offers free estimates and provides clear pricing.
- Be wary of plumbers who are pushy or aggressive in their sales tactics – they might be using high-pressure techniques to get the job done quickly.
